Girls Lax

Find out what's happening in Yorktown-Somersfor free with the latest updates from Patch.

Lakeland/Panas' Alexa BonnesEmma Bozek and Chyna Hill and Yorktown's Katie Frederick and Heather Raniolo made The Journal News/LoHud.com Westchester/Putnam first team all-star squad as reported by Chris Perez on LoHud.com.

Lakeland/Panas' Allie O'Mara and Amelia Lopez and Yorktown's Stef Ranagan were named to the second team.

Somers' Emma Schurr and Tara Schurr, Kennedy Catholic's Daniella Torchia and Lakeland/Panas' Molly Fitzpatrick were named honorable mention.

Baseball

Yorktown is in first place in the 9-year-old division of the Westchester Putnam Baseball Association with a 5-0 record.
